The problems Boston homes offer an electrical repair
Older areas like Dorchester, Roslindale, and East Boston contain residences that tell an electrician precisely when they were developed the minute the panel door swings open. I have actually opened up plenty that still had cloth-insulated wiring, short-run branch circuits, or an overloaded subpanel serving a basement home included decades later. The signs and symptoms differ. Lights brightening when the fridge cycles. GFCIs that trip on damp days however behave in winter. Two-prong receptacles in living rooms with a rat's nest of adapters. Each of these tells a story concerning the home's bones.
Boston's seaside air accelerates corrosion, specifically anywhere the solution decrease hardware or meter outlet is subjected. I once replied to duplicated breaker journeys in a South Boston triple-decker where the problem became moisture invasion through hairline cracks in the service head. Salt plus condensation ate the neutral lug. The solution had not been attractive: change the pole, weatherhead, and lugs, reseal, and validate bonding and grounding at the water solution. The payoff was immediate, and the nuisance journeys vanished.

Safety first, speed second
There's a time for rapid fixes. There's also a time to decrease. If you scent burning near an electrical outlet, feel heat at a button plate, or notification arcing sounds at a panel, power down that circuit and call a licensed pro. Very same recommendations for flickering lights come with by a searing sound or a breaker that trips quickly with absolutely nothing plugged in. These are indications of loose conductors, stopping working breakers, or compromised insulation, and proceeded usage dangers a fire.
I get asked about DIY at all times. Exchanging a light fixture can be straightforward, offered the box is rated for the component's weight and you recognize how to secure the devices grounding conductor. The lines blur when you step into multiwire branch circuits, shared neutrals, or boxes crowded past capacity. Boston's brownstones usually have really shallow stonework boxes; pressing in a modern-day smart dimmer without resolving quantity and heat dissipation can lead to chronic failings. When doubtful, seek advice from, not guess.
What to get out of a correct electrical diagnosis
A good medical diagnosis starts with paying attention. A home owner that states, "The bedroom lights lower when the home window a/c kicks on," has actually provided you a clue concerning voltage drop and potentially a shared circuit at its limit. Afterwards, we examine. A trusted professional will certainly determine voltage at the panel and at end-of-line receptacles, check breaker torque, evaluate for double-lugged neutrals, and seek warm trademarks with a thermal camera when ideal. In older homes, we examine GFCIs and AFCIs under lots, not just with the onboard button, because problem journeys can hide inadequate connections or shared neutrals that require reconfiguration.
Permitting is part of the task for anything beyond like-for-like swaps. That consists of panel substitutes, new circuits, and major repairs to service equipment. In Boston, authorizations are filed with the Inspectional Services Division. The best electrical repair service Boston offers will certainly manage this instantly and routine assessments without placing that problem on you.

Panel upgrades still provide worth. Lots of homes carry 60 or 100 amps of service, which functioned penalty when the largest draw was a central heating boiler and a couple of devices. Include an EV battery charger, mini-splits for air conditioning, and an induction cooktop, and you'll appreciate 150 to 200 amps. Upgrading is not just about the primary breaker. It's a chance to tidy up neutrals and premises, label circuits, add rise defense, and prepare for future loads.
Grounding and bonding enhancements silently fix numerous gremlins. I have seen recurring shocks at a kitchen sink removed by bonding a brand-new copper water service properly to the panel and verifying the extra ground rods. In one more situation, computer systems randomly restarted during tornados up until we included a whole-home rise protective gadget and tightened up a loose neutral bar.
Aluminum branch circuits from the 60s and 70s appear sometimes. They can be risk-free when dealt with appropriately, but the link factors are prone. Copalum crimping or AlumiConn ports, installed by qualified service technicians, minimize danger without gutting walls. Pigtailing with simple cable nuts is not acceptable.
Knob-and-tube shows up in pockets, in some cases buried behind later restorations. By code, you can not hide active knob-and-tube under insulation. If you're insulating an attic in Jamaica Level, plan to change those runs or separate them before the cellulose gets here. Smart sequencing between electrician and insulation specialist conserves money.
Weather, salt, and the case for aggressive maintenance
Boston throws salt spray, wind, ice, and sticky summertime moisture at anything installed outside. Solution heads split, meter sockets oxidize, channel seals loosen. A once-a-year aesthetic check captures damages prior to it waterfalls. Plenty of trusted electrician Boston groups offer upkeep strategies that include tightening panel terminations, testing GFCI/AFCI tools, confirming ground insusceptibility, and examining tons distribution.
I suggest taking notice of exterior outlets and components, especially on coastal-facing walls. Swap used gaskets, use in-use covers for receptacles, and select fixtures with marine-grade surfaces when you are within a mile or two of the harbor. On decks and roofing outdoor patios, make sure boxes are wet-location rated and correctly supported; I still find fixtures hung from old pancake boxes on outside soffits where a deeper, gasketed box needs to have been used.

True rate versus guesswork
Ballpark pricing helps establish assumptions, with the caution that website problems drive cost more than any type of listing you'll locate on-line. In the last 2 years, I have actually seen panel swaps in Boston array from regarding 2,000 bucks for a straightforward 100-amp to 200-amp upgrade in a single-family home, approximately 5,000 to 7,000 bucks when solution relocation, stonework job, and meter upgrades were involved. Dedicated 240-volt circuits for an EV battery charger can be a couple of hundred bucks if the panel is near the parking area and capability exists, or numerous thousand when avenue goes through ended up areas or trenching is needed. Troubleshooting a strange outage could be a short diagnostic that ends with replacing a stopped working GFCI, or it can reveal aged electrical wiring that qualities a phased rewiring plan. Openness beats reduced quotes that mushroom later.

The wise home wrinkle
Boston homes have actually welcomed wise thermostats, dimmers, and whole-house systems. These integrate magnificently when mounted with interest to principles. Neutral accessibility at button areas is the very first hurdle. Lots of older button loopholes do not have neutrals in the box; requiring wise tools right into these boxes develops flicker, ghosting, or tool failure. A thoughtful electrician will certainly run a neutral where required or define tools created for two-wire settings that still meet code.
Radio frequency congestion is likewise actual in thick communities. A financial institution of condos with overlapping Wi-Fi and Zigbee or Z-Wave networks can make devices act unexpectedly. Experienced installers position repeaters carefully, sector networks, and choose items with trusted regional control so you are not stuck when the net hiccups.
Energy and electrification, Boston-style
Electrification isn't simply a buzzword when your gas infrastructure is aging and your old vapor central heating boiler moans with February. Heat pumps, induction cooking, and heat pump water heaters are now typical around the city. These upgrades regularly set off panel assessments, and occasionally service upgrades. An excellent electrical expert goes through load computations making use of sensible obligation cycles as opposed to worst-case piling of every home appliance at the same time. Smart panels or tons monitoring gadgets can stay clear of a costly service upgrade when the home's envelope and way of living enable it. For example, a load-shedding tool can briefly stop EV billing when the oven and dryer are in usage, remaining within a 100-amp service's capacity.
Solar adds one more layer. Interconnection in Boston is fully grown, however you still need clear labeling, correct fast closure devices, and upgraded grounding and bonding at the service. If you prepare to add battery storage later on, ask your electrician to pre-wire channel between panel and prospective battery location. Tiny choices like avenue sizing and path save hours down the line.
Tenant buildings and condo specifics
Triple-deckers and condo conversions present common infrastructure. I've mediated greater than one debate over a flickering hallway light that tied back to a neutral shared incorrectly between devices. Tidy splitting up of meters, panels, and neutrals avoids conflicts and fire dangers. Alike areas, use tamper-resistant, self-testing GFCI outlets, and clearly tag which panel feeds what. For apartment associations, set an annual allocate electric upkeep, much like roof covering, due to the fact that postponed electric issues at some point become emergency calls at the worst time.
Rental devices need tamper-resistant receptacles and smoke and carbon monoxide gas detection that fulfills present code. Switching expired 9-volt detectors for hardwired, adjoined units with battery backup is a straightforward retrofit that significantly enhances safety. Deal with an electrical contractor who comprehends assessment requirements for rental certifications and can offer the necessary documentation.
Small fixings that make a large difference
Not every phone call is a panel modification. A number of the most effective lasting enhancements are modest.
Replacing old two-prong receptacles with correctly grounded, three-prong receptacles gets rid of the daisy chain of adapters and hazardous bootleg premises that surface in older units. Where grounding isn't existing and rewiring is not immediately viable, a GFCI receptacle labeled "No Devices Ground" is a defensible acting remedy, though not a replacement for a true ground when delicate electronic devices are involved.
Installing tamper-resistant outlets throughout homes with children protects against the spying of interested fingers or barrettes. It's inexpensive and needed by code forever reason.
Adding whole-home surge security guards devices and electronics versus spikes, especially in areas with regular outages. A single gadget at the panel, combined with quality point-of-use guards for sensitive tools, provides layered protection.
Kitchen and bath upgrades are typically simply adding the best circuits, not ripping out coatings. Devoted circuits for microwaves, dishwashers, and disposals keep problem trips away. In older galley kitchens common to many Boston apartments, careful positioning and checking of small appliance circuits avoids overloading the one counter outlet everybody uses for toaster and espresso machines.
